草庐IT

half-screen-dialog

全部标签

ios - 为什么 UIView 比 Screen 宽

我已经使用界面生成器创建了一个ViewController,同时启用了大小类。View对其父View(ViewController的View)具有前导和尾随约束。像这样。|-(14)-(View)-(14)-|当我运行该应用程序时,它看起来很棒,View的两侧都有14pt的插图,但当我打印它的宽度时,我得到576,这比屏幕宽度还宽。在界面生成器中,View的框架宽度设置为576(作为打开尺寸类别时的Canvas尺寸),但在运行时约束应该覆盖这个我猜想。为什么View显示正确,但它的框架显示更大的宽度?? 最佳答案 你什么时候打印的宽

ios - 代码 : Stack View Move to next line if screen is too small

使用StackView,我想得到3个并排的项目,我实现了:但是,我想要做的是,如果屏幕太小而无法很好地容纳所有内容,则将block移动到下一行,例如:我不应该为此使用StackView吗?示例项目的Github版本:https://github.com/jzhang172/StackTest 最佳答案 UIStackViews无法执行那种将溢出发送到新行AFAIK的自动布局。对于您要尝试做的事情,根据您的目的,还有其他几种选择。在大型UIScrollView中嵌入多个堆栈View并将其调整大小以仅显示第一行。稍后可以“增长”该Scr

ios - 无法更新 dialog.data Quickblox[iOS]

我需要在聊天对话框中存储自定义参数,但该对话框无法使用新参数进行更新。在两个打印语句中,ChatDialog和updatedDialog下的那个;仍然是(null)中的数据字段。我已按照Quickblox网站上的步骤进行操作,但仍然失败。我在这里遗漏了什么吗?chatDialog?.data=["UserID":"2342342342134231412342"]print("Chatdialog")print(chatDialog)QBRequest.update(chatDialog!,successBlock:{(response,updatedDialog)inguardupda

ios - MonoTouch.Dialog 事件和部分

我还需要一个帮助。第一个问题是:我了解到MonoTouch.Dialog上的部分、文本、图像等将动态创建。但是我也可以有按钮吗?如果是,我如何绑定(bind)该按钮的事件。第二个问题是:基本上我有一个搜索文本和一个按钮,单击按钮时,文本被发送到Twitter-url,以获取推文,这些推文需要显示,现在它们包含、图像、文本、回复和收藏夹。搜索结果和搜索按钮+编辑框可以成为一个ViewController的一部分吗? 最佳答案 Butcanihavebuttonsaswell?DialogViewController中的Element通

ios - Dialog 'apprequests' 好友邀请发送成功但始终打不通。 (iOS)

我在获取friend邀请时遇到问题。他们似乎发送正常(我没有收到来自iOS代表的任何错误),但邀请从未出现在接收者的FB帐户上。我正在使用iOSSDK并使用测试用户登录。我用来创建邀请对话框的代码是:NSMutableDictionary*dict=[NSMutableDictionarydictionary];[dictsetValue:@"接受我的邀请"forKey:@"message"];[_facebookdialog:@"apprequests"andParams:dictandDelegate:self];这会弹出一个对话框,我可以在其中选择要邀请的friend。当我点击“

ios - 核心剧情: first/last point symbol is out of screen

我有一个简单的问题,但我不知道如何解决。当我布置我的情节时,我为每个点使用CPTPlotSymbol。符号是一个圆圈。问题是在第一个点和最后一个点上只有一半的圆是可见的。(由于情节的位置)。有没有办法在图中显示完整的符号?我已经尝试增加绘图的填充和绘图区域,但没有奏效。感谢和问候,彼得 最佳答案 您需要扩大违规绘图范围以为符号腾出空间。使用visibleRange和gridLinesRange来限制轴和网格线的大小。以下是执行此操作的PlotGallery示例应用程序中控制图的一些代码:CPTMutablePlotRange*xRa

c# - 使用 MonoTouch.Dialog 时更改 TabBarController 和 NavigationController

我正在尝试更改导航栏Controller和标签栏Controller的颜色我正在使用monotouch.dialog构建我的应用程序并具有以下代码publicpartialclassAppDelegate:UIApplicationDelegate{//class-leveldeclarationsUIWindowwindow;////Thismethodisinvokedwhentheapplicationhasloadedandisreadytorun.Inthis//methodyoushouldinstantiatethewindow,loadtheUIintoitandthe

c# - MonoTouch.Dialog:具有值的 StringElement,但在 UI 中隐藏值?

我希望用户从众多元素中选择一个。所以我正在创建一长串StringElement,每个列表都有一个特定的标题。每个元素都与特定值相关联。我的想法是设置StringElement的Value属性。但是,这会使值显示在元素的右侧。如何隐藏这个值?我仅在用户点击条目时才需要它。 最佳答案 除了最基本的设置之类的对话框,我最终(90%的时间)定义了我自己的Element类型。它解决了许多问题(例如这个问题)并减少了重复代码。所以你会得到类似的东西:classMyStringElement:StringElement{publicMyStrin

c# - MonoTouch.Dialog - 接受空值作为输入的 DateElement

我在网上搜索无果...我正在使用MT.D并想使用DateElement为某人设置生日,但生日可能为空,这意味着尚未收集数据。有人知道如何让DateElement接受空值或日期吗? 最佳答案 更新20140106:自iOS7发布以来,Apple希望日期/时间选择器与内容内联,而不是操作表,或者在本例中是全屏覆盖。因此,此代码仅用于操作指南和历史目的。好的,所以我推出了自己的类(class)。我个人认为当前的日期/时间选择器设置看起来不像弹出一个带有日期选择器的等效ActionSheet那样专业。对MT.D更有经验的人可能能够弄清楚,但

ios - MonoTouch.Dialog:没有ImageUrl时,默认图片在StyledStringElement上

我正在设置StyledStringElement的ImageUrl,但不知道url是否存在。我想放入一个placeholderimage直到图像被成功下载:varitem=newStyledStringElement(n.Title);item.ImageUri=newUri(n.ImageThumbUrl);我现在明白了: 最佳答案 有帮助:http://yusinto.blogspot.ca/2012/05/background-image-downloading-with.html我将StyledStringElement复制